<4.0-Rated Hotels Near Waitrose & Partners

Premier Inn London Twickenham Stadium

Premier Inn London Twickenham Stadium

3.6 / 5
416 Chertsey Rd
2.03KM from Waitrose & Partners
Luggage StorageParking
per night
From
USD**1
London Twickenham East

London Twickenham East

3.5 / 5
Corner, Sixth Cross Rd, Staines Rd
2.38KM from Waitrose & Partners
Luggage StorageParking
per night
From
USD**9
Twickenham Guest House

Twickenham Guest House

3.4 / 5
10 Russell Rd
0.84KM from Waitrose & Partners
Luggage StorageParking
per night
From
USD**0
The White Hart Inn

The White Hart Inn

3.8 / 5
121 Kneller Rd
1.93KM from Waitrose & Partners
BarChildren's MealBarbecueLuggage StorageBarbecue AvailableParking
per night
From
USD**7